The location of Hotel Le Clarisse al Pantheon was absolutely perfect - 2 blocks from the Pantheon, with its lively piazza, and very close to all the main sites you want to see in Rome. It was an ideal starting point for wherever we wanted to walk to and explore each day. The breakfast was always a great experience and the room was clean, with the exception of some tiny mildew spots in the shower. But it was spacious and everything worked great. Our only complaint was street noise. We liked to keep the window open at night so it wasn’t so hot but there was traffic noise from street sweepers and garbage trucks and other vehicles all night long. Not much they can do about that and it definitely did not ruin our whole experience. I would recommend this hotel.

The room was very good. It had a very comfy bed, was very close to almost of the big tourist attractions, and the room itself had a lot of space (more comparable to an American hotel room than the typical Italian hotel in our experience). It did have two downsides tho: 1. The shower floor was Ridiculously slippery, my wife and I both slipped and fell in it. (We are not clumsy, and didn’t have an issue in the other 3 notes we stayed at while in Italy. 2. The hotel used a website on your phone to unlock the room and building doors instead of a traditional physical key this is a good idea but in practice the website was very slow and sometimes took several minutes to get a door to open.

What a wonderful hideaway hotel which is convenient to all the major sites in Rome one wants to see when visiting. It was especially perfect for someone who does not like being in the middle of all the noise and crowds We were first welcomed by Sara who gave us some great information and a couple of recommendations for restaurants not touristy, she was also very helpful in giving us additional information in ordering a taxi for us to the airport on the day of our departure The hotel is super convenient to transportation, whether it’s the buses the tram or just walking everywhere. You would not know it’s a hotel as it appears to be a part of a residential building. The accommodations were clean comfortable. There was a small refrigerator and an electric tea kettle with some tea and coffee available for use. Every morning we were provided a lovely breakfast on the terrace, which is perfect to start our day. Even in the colder month during the rain, we were able to sit outside under their enclosed area. Service was lovely. For those unfamiliar with European bathrooms, there was a bidet in the bathroom and our room had a very large soaking tub. However, like a lot of other European accommodations there was no hands-free shower, rather in order to wash one’s hair you have to hold the handheld shower component whilst sitting in the tub. A minor inconvenience which was traded off by having a lovely soak in the tub. If you are a light averse sleeper, the Wi-Fi blinked.
